This is my second RC Tank, on this version i wanted to focus on speed and all terrain capability.
This version was designed so that all the parts could be 3D printed. You will need to purchase some fasteners and bearings:
M3 x 40mm button head screws for the tracks
M3 x 12mm button head screws for the frame
M3 nylon locking nuts for tracks and frame
12 x 6000 size bearings
2 x 540 size motors (I use 55T)
ESC drives for the motors
1 or 2 batteries used for quadcopters and planes
M3 Push Fit Thread inserts (4mm OD, 5mm L)
the Axels and mounting pillars all need the threaded insert to work properly.
The tracks do fit nicely around the frame but i have not put them into the assembly as it was not needed (and difficult)
as for the electronics i have designed my own controller and motherboard.
Feel free to ask me about my board and if you want the designs and firmware, if not you can use your own controller and receiver. My board uses a HC-12 module capable of 1km rage. My device also has stall detection on each side and temperature monitoring on each of the motors and ESC. The PCB Panel Part has mounting pillars for the motherboard PCB
There are mounting holes for the communication antennas (Both FPV and Controller Antennas), there is also a toggle switch mounting hole.
